Alumni Volunteer of the Month May’s volunteer is very persuasive. ![]() Dr. Richard Waites Dr. Richard Waites, who earned a Ph.D. in Psychology from Walden University in 2000, is the Alumni Association’s choice for May’s Volunteer of the Month.
Waites, a board-certified civil trial attorney and a trial psychologist, volunteered to present the April Alumni Lecture Series, “Public Speaking: How to Persuade Other Professional People.” The response was so overwhelming that he has offered to do another presentation for those who were unable to participate.
Waites is the CEO of The Advocates and Advocacy Sciences Inc., a leading U.S. trial consulting firm. He has helped with trial strategy, witness training and jury selection in more than 1,000 civil cases. He also has written or contributed to 11 books and more than 40 articles, including Courtroom Psychology and Trial Advocacy.
